| From: | Simon Riggs <simon(at)2ndQuadrant(dot)com> |
|---|---|
| To: | Heikki Linnakangas <heikki(dot)linnakangas(at)enterprisedb(dot)com> |
| Cc: | pgsql-hackers <pgsql-hackers(at)postgresql(dot)org> |
| Subject: | Re: Hot Standby 0.2.1 |
| Date: | 2009-10-07 13:52:04 |
| Message-ID: | 1254923524.26302.229.camel@ebony.2ndQuadrant |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-hackers |
On Tue, 2009-09-22 at 12:53 +0300, Heikki Linnakangas wrote:
> It looks like the standby tries to remove XID 4323 from the
> known-assigned hash table, but it's not there because it was removed
> and set in pg_subtrans by an XLOG_XACT_ASSIGNMENT record earlier. I
> guess we should just not throw an error in that case, but is there a
> way we could catch that narrow case and still keep the check in
> KnownAssignedXidsRemove()? It seems like the check might help catch
> other bugs, so I'd rather keep it if possible.
Fix attached.
--
Simon Riggs www.2ndQuadrant.com
| Attachment | Content-Type | Size |
|---|---|---|
| 4c10a767f23d918cdde8366408d88b1c801ca1c9.patch | text/x-patch | 735 bytes |
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Simon Riggs | 2009-10-07 13:56:41 | Re: COPY enhancements |
| Previous Message | Dimitri Fontaine | 2009-10-07 13:33:01 | Re: COPY enhancements |